Why Traditional Beds Are a Problem in Small Apartments

In many apartments, the bed is the largest piece of furniture in the room.

A standard single or double bed occupies floor space 24 hours a day, even when it is only used for sleeping. This often leaves less room for work, storage, hobbies, or entertaining guests.

For people living in studio apartments, guest rooms, or multifunctional spaces, finding a better use of available square footage becomes increasingly important.


What Makes a Murphy Bed Different?

A Murphy bed folds vertically against the wall when not in use.

Instead of dedicating an entire room to sleeping, the same space can be used for:

  • Working from home
  • Studying
  • Reading
  • Creative projects
  • Hosting guests
  • Daily living activities

Modern Murphy beds have evolved far beyond simple fold-away beds and often include desks, shelving, and integrated storage.

Pros and Cons of a Murphy Bed

Advantages

✔ Saves valuable floor space

✔ Creates a multifunctional room

✔ Keeps interiors organized

✔ Works well in apartments and guest rooms

✔ Eliminates the need for separate furniture

✔ Can increase usable living space

Things to Consider Before Buying

✖ Requires wall mounting for safe installation (the unit is relatively lightweight and designed for straightforward installation)

✖ Higher initial investment than a basic bed frame (while replacing multiple furniture pieces at once)

✖ Best suited for users who want a flexible room layout rather than a permanently open bed

For most small-space homeowners, the benefits significantly outweigh the limitations.


Is a Murphy Bed Better Than a Sofa Bed?

While sofa beds are popular, they often compromise both comfort and functionality.

Murphy beds typically offer:

  • Better sleeping comfort
  • More stable mattress support
  • Larger usable workspace options
  • Cleaner room organization

For people who frequently work from home, a Murphy bed with desk often provides greater long-term value.
